The Generic Structures of Narrative Essay
1. Orientation
Orientation is the opening paragraph of the text that introduces
the characters involved, the time when it happened, and the
background location of the event (who, when, and where).
2. Complication
Complication is located after orientation and consists of
paragraphs that explain the initial problem. This initial problem is
the beginning of the storyline that continues in the conflict, climax,
and anticlimax of a story.
3. Sequence of Events
Sequence of events in a narrative text shows the interaction
in which the characters in the story react to the complication.
4. Resolution
Resolution is the paragraph that ends the story, which
is the resolution and the end of the story. The problems in a
narrative text must be resolved and closed with a happy ending
or a tragic and sad ending.
5. Reorientation
Reorientation is the closing sentence that tells the final
state of the character in the story and is the moral message in a
narrative story.
